Emerging Trends in PR for the Gambling Industry

The gambling industry faces rapid technological advancement and shifting consumer expectations, making public relations more critical than ever. New technologies like artificial intelligence and blockchain are reshaping how gambling companies communicate with their audiences and build trust. PR professionals must now master these tools while maintaining compliance with strict regulatory requirements. Recent data shows that 73% of gambling operators are investing in AI and blockchain technologies to improve transparency and customer engagement, according to a 2023 report by Gaming Innovation Group.

AI-Powered Personalization in Gambling PR

PR teams in the gambling sector now use artificial intelligence to create targeted communication strategies that resonate with specific player segments. AI algorithms analyze vast amounts of player data, including betting patterns, game preferences, and engagement history, to craft messages that speak directly to individual interests and concerns.

Machine learning tools help PR professionals identify the most effective communication channels and timing for different player groups. For example, some players respond better to email communications about responsible gaming tools, while others prefer in-app notifications about new security features.

AI-driven sentiment analysis monitors social media and online forums to gauge public perception and identify potential PR challenges before they escalate. This proactive approach allows gambling companies to address concerns quickly and maintain positive brand relationships.

Personalization extends to content creation, where AI tools help generate variations of PR materials tailored to different demographics. A 2023 study by the American Gaming Association found that personalized responsible gaming messages increased player engagement with safety tools by 47% compared to generic communications.

Blockchain Technology and Trust Building

Blockchain technology provides gambling companies with powerful tools to demonstrate transparency and build trust through PR initiatives. The technology’s immutable ledger system creates verifiable records of all gaming transactions, allowing companies to prove fair play definitively.

Smart contracts automatically execute payouts and gaming outcomes, eliminating human intervention and potential manipulation. PR teams can point to these automated systems as evidence of their commitment to fairness. According to recent data from the Blockchain Gaming Alliance, 68% of players report increased trust in operators who implement blockchain-based verification systems.

PR professionals now incorporate blockchain verification features into their communication strategies. They create educational content explaining how players can verify game outcomes and transaction histories independently. This transparency builds credibility and differentiates blockchain-enabled operators from traditional platforms.

The technology also supports responsible gaming initiatives through transparent self-exclusion programs and spending limits. PR teams highlight these features to demonstrate their commitment to player protection and regulatory compliance.

Adapting PR Strategies to Consumer Preferences

Modern gambling consumers demand more control over their gaming experience and greater transparency from operators. PR strategies must evolve to address these changing preferences while maintaining regulatory compliance.

Privacy concerns rank high among player priorities. PR messaging now emphasizes data protection measures and player anonymity options, particularly in jurisdictions where privacy regulations are strict. Communications highlight encryption technologies and secure payment methods that protect player information.

Players increasingly value social responsibility in gambling operations. PR teams develop campaigns that showcase responsible gaming tools, community support programs, and environmental initiatives. These efforts help build trust and position operators as responsible industry leaders.

Mobile-first communication strategies reflect the shift toward mobile gaming. PR materials are optimized for mobile devices, and campaigns integrate with popular messaging platforms where players spend their time.

Implementation Steps for New PR Technologies

Successful implementation of AI and blockchain in PR requires careful planning and execution. The first step involves auditing current PR capabilities and identifying areas where new technologies can add value.

PR teams should start with pilot programs to test AI-powered personalization tools. This might include A/B testing different message variations or implementing automated response systems for common player inquiries. Success metrics should track engagement rates, response times, and player satisfaction.

For blockchain implementation, PR professionals should work closely with technical teams to understand the technology’s capabilities and limitations. This knowledge enables accurate communication about blockchain features and benefits to players.

Training programs help PR staff master new tools and technologies. Regular updates ensure teams stay current with technological advances and changing best practices in digital PR.

Regulatory Compliance and Ethical Considerations

PR teams must balance innovation with strict regulatory requirements in the gambling industry. Communications about new technologies should clearly state compliance measures and responsible gaming policies.

Messaging about AI personalization must address data privacy concerns and comply with regulations like GDPR. PR materials should explain how player data is collected, used, and protected.

When promoting blockchain features, PR teams must ensure claims about transparency and fairness meet regulatory standards. Communications should include appropriate disclaimers and responsible gaming messages.

Regular consultation with legal teams helps ensure PR materials meet compliance requirements across different jurisdictions. This collaboration prevents regulatory issues while maintaining effective communication.
